R Kelly's musical career took off with the release of his debut album "Born into the 90's" in 1992, as part of the group Public Announcement. His solo career began shortly after, with the release of his second album "12 Play" in 1993, which included the hit single "Bump n' Grind." This album marked the beginning of a successful solo career, characterized by chart-topping hits and a distinctive style.

"Satisfy You" was a commercial success, peaking at number two on the Billboard Hot 100 chart.
The creation of "Satisfy You" was a meticulous process that involved both P Diddy and R Kelly's creative input. The song's production was handled by P Diddy, who brought his signature style to the track, while R Kelly contributed his vocal talents and songwriting expertise.
